Ten minutes later, the four of them were standing outside the arcade, only just realizing what Shirley meant by “walking off the food.” She had dragged them here for games, not a stroll.

“Playing games at home just isn’t the same. The arcade is so much more fun,” Shirley said, her eyes already searching for the token machine. “Come on, let’s hurry up and get tokens. They’re running a holiday deal—twenty-nine bucks for a hundred coins.”

“I say we each get a hundred and have a claw machine showdown,” she suggested, getting more excited. “Whoever scores the most plushies wins. You guys in?”

It sounded like a good idea to Claire, so she nodded. Sophia and Len were quick to agree, both of them way too competitive to say no.

At school, the four of them were always at the top of the class. They just assumed being good at claw machines would come naturally, too.

But after half an hour and close to a hundred tokens each, reality set in. Sophia didn’t catch a single prize. Shirley barely managed to get two.

Len and Claire, though, kept racking up the wins.

“What’s up with those two? How are they so good at this?” Shirley said, half admiring, half exasperated.

In the end, Shirley and Sophia gave up, standing on either side of Len and Claire and just watching.

Claire had captured seven plushies, Len was right behind with six. Someone even brought over two shopping carts to hold all their winnings. They still had about thirty tokens left each.

Shirley quietly leaned over to Sophia and whispered, “Are straight-A students just naturally good at this stuff?”

Sophia grinned. “They’re probably running formulas through their heads, calculating the exact second to press the button for a perfect catch.”

She might have been joking, but she wasn’t wrong.

By the time they ran out of tokens, Claire had caught thirteen plushies and Len had eleven. Even the arcade staff were impressed.

“Wow, that’s the most anyone’s won all day,” one of them said, shaking their head.

They let the group trade in a bunch of smaller plushies for the big ones. Shirley picked a giant bunny, Sophia chose a dinosaur. Claire grabbed a long hippopotamus she could use as a body pillow. Len got one too, though he didn’t say anything about his choice.
